About 404 Brookhollow Dr

Welcome to 404 Brookhollow Drive — a roomy, well-cared-for Cape Cod in York’s established Brookside community. This home delivers 5 bedrooms and 2.5 baths across approximately 2,303 square feet, including a finished addition that creates two flexible spaces ideal for home offices, media, crafts, or guest rooms. The addition currently lacks closets; with minimal work those rooms convert easily to formal bedrooms to suit growing families.

Step inside to find a practical layout: living and dining areas flow for everyday life and entertaining, while the kitchen serves as a central hub with built-in microwave, exhaust hood, and the convenience of a gas water heater. Flooring is a mix of carpet and vinyl—durable and family friendly—and the interior systems include forced-air natural gas heat and central air with ceiling fans for comfort year-round. A main-level utility room adds day-to-day convenience.

Outside, the property sits on a generous 0.30-acre corner lot with mature landscaping and space for outdoor living, play, or a potential detached garage/structure. The yard orientation and lot size make this one of the larger parcels available at this price tier in York. Parking is on-site via driveway with additional street parking available.

Location is a standout: you’re minutes from a compact downtown York with restaurants, local shops, and community events, while commuting connections to Rock Hill and Charlotte are straightforward. The home is part of an HOA—verify rules and fees with the listing agent—but the neighborhood character is quiet, family-oriented and well-maintained. Market Insights

York’s housing market sits between small-town stability and Charlotte-area spillover demand. Inventory remains relatively tight for affordable single-family homes, supporting steady pricing and quicker sales for properly priced properties. At a list price of $369,999 (about $161/sf), this home competes well against 1990s-era homes in the area—especially given the extra finished spaces. Buyers seeking commuter access to Rock Hill or Charlotte will find York attractive for its lower cost basis and community amenities. Expect motivated family buyers and investors who value bedroom count and yard space; sellers should emphasize the lot and flexible rooms while disclosing permitting details for the addition.

Things to Consider

  • Permitting status for finished addition is unknown—may affect legal bedroom count and appraisal
  • No attached garage may be a negative for some buyers and could impact resale vs. neighboring homes
  • Assessed values, taxes, and title history not provided—buyer should verify

Opportunity Analysis

Acquire a competitively priced 5-bedroom single-family home with built-in occupancy flexibility in York. Convert the two addition rooms into permitted bedrooms (add closets and secure retroactive permits if needed), update finishes selectively, and market to families or long-term renters seeking extra bedrooms near downtown York.

Potential Use Scenarios

  • Perform due diligence on permitting for the finished addition; budget for any required corrective work.
  • Add closets to the two addition rooms to establish legal bedroom footprint if desired.
  • Cosmetic kitchen and bathroom refresh to increase market appeal; target mid-range finishes.
  • Consider building a detached garage or covered carport if parking demand supports value-add.

Risk Factors

  • Permitting and potential costs to legalize the addition
  • Local market sensitivity to lack of garage in this segment
  • Financing/insurability implications if bedroom count is adjusted post-close
